Mineral Specimen #4006 Native Copper Crystals with partial Cuprite Coating
Bisbee, Warren District, Mule Mts, Cochise Co., Arizona
6.9 x 3.6 x 3.3 cm
Sold
Ex. A. E. Seaman Museum
A group of native Copper crystals from the classic Bisbee location. Areas of the specimen have well formed crystals with a light patina. Other areas are coated with a thin layer of Cuprite and likely Tenorite.
The specimen is in good condition with no appreciable damage.
